Zankov famously uses "collisions" (противоречия)—giving a child a task they don't yet have the tools to solve. This sparks curiosity. poiasnitelnaia zapiska po matematike 1klass zankova
In the world of Russian primary education, the "System of L.V. Zankov" is often whispered about with a mix of awe and slight intimidation by parents. If you are drafting a (Explanatory Note) for 1st-grade Mathematics under this curriculum, you aren't just writing a bureaucratic document—you are mapping out a journey into "developmental teaching." 1.
